    POSITION SUMMARY Provide quality assurance system support to achieve optimal safety, quality, productivity and delivery to assure internal and external customer satisfaction. P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ES Intermediate to advanced level position where colleague has reached competency in the discipline. Understands and applies concepts. Performs varied and more complex tasks, using independent judgment with minimum supervision. Makes decisions within broad parameters. May mentor less experienced colleagues.

    • Support the Company''s mission, vision, values and goals in the performance of daily activities.

    • Provide key input into the development of departmental strategic goals along with identifying key measurable to support the departmental goals.

    • Responsible for performance feedback and leadership of all direct reports including mentoring, coaching, counseling and corrective action when situations dictate.

    • Ensure product and process compliance to customer and TS 16949 requirements.

    • Support corporate in standardization activities.

    • Serve as focal point of contact for internal and external customers either directly or through the Customer Liaison.

    • Serve as main contact for external customer concerns. Monitor, respond, initiate corrective actions, follow up, close and track customer complaints.

    • Performs research, design and development for quality processes and controls.

    • Evaluates designs, drawings, project plans, specifications and other documents.

    • Maintenance of the Process Sign Off Books, and job books (for manufacturing).

    • Work in conjunction with engineering; coordinate the PPAP (Product Part Approval Process) for new programs, program moves, engineering changes and process improvements.

    • Travel to customers, vendors and suppliers as necessary. Generate and distribute visitation reports along with any other customer communications.

    • Analyze SPC data for process improvement, corrective actions and other activities.

    • Initiate, facilitate and participate in cross-functional teams in pursuit of problem solving and mistake proofing quality problems.

    • Drive implementation of a progressive quality system to prevent defects and meet or exceed customer expectation.

    • Drive implementation of all quality policies and required operating procedures and work instructions.

    • Develop and maintain Company performance metric data, prepare charts and summaries for applicable measureables as required.

    • Directs colleagues engaged in measuring and testing product and tabulating data concerning materials, product, or process quality and reliability.

    • Provide training and support for the Quality Technicians and manufacturing colleagues, including gage training.

    • Ensure effective containment actions are in place to protect customers when a quality issue is identified

    • Support plant activities towards achieving customer awards and Quality registration (ex. TS 16949, ISO 14001, Pentastar, etc.)

    • Assist with plant activities to achieve quality, productivity and cost reduction goals.

    • Provide guidance to the plant for internal rejects and rework procedures.

    • Interface as required with the CMM programmers on layout issues and the Weld Assurance Technician on weld issues.

    • Support all quality systems, both development and maintenance per TS16949 requirements.

    • Generate quality alerts and communicate alerts to the production floor.
